Tri Merge Credit Report

This detailed summary consolidates credit data from the three major credit reporting agencies: Equifax, Experian, and TransUnion. It presents a comprehensive overview of an individual’s credit history, encompassing information such as payment history, outstanding debts, credit utilization, and public records. As an example, it would reveal all open accounts, late payments reported to any of the three bureaus, and any bankruptcies or liens filed.

The aggregated report is invaluable for various reasons. Lenders rely on it to gain a complete picture of an applicant’s creditworthiness, enabling more informed lending decisions. Individuals can utilize it to identify errors or inconsistencies across their credit files, proactively addressing inaccuracies that could negatively impact their credit scores. Furthermore, it provides a benchmark for monitoring credit health and implementing strategies for improvement. Its use facilitates fair and accurate assessments of risk, benefiting both creditors and consumers. Understanding it’s importance in financial sectors has grown over time.

Conclusion

This exploration of the tri merge credit report has underscored its pivotal role in both lending decisions and individual financial oversight. Its comprehensive nature, drawing data from Equifax, Experian, and TransUnion, provides a far more complete and accurate representation of creditworthiness than single-bureau reports. The ability to identify discrepancies and potential fraud across multiple sources is paramount for maintaining financial integrity.

Therefore, diligent monitoring and proactive management of the data contained within these reports are not merely recommended, but essential. The information contained within this report directly impacts access to credit, interest rates, and various other financial opportunities. As such, informed action based on regular review and verification constitutes a critical component of responsible financial stewardship.
